Chile: Wine exports do not reach those of 2022

According to data from the Spanish Wine Market Observatory (OeMv), although there was a slight increase in Chilean wine exports in the first half of 2024, the decline in the Chinese market and the decrease in prices, slowed the recovery of this important sector. The fall of the Chinese market and the decrease in the average price slowed the recovery of this important sector.

Chilean wine exports have shown a slight recovery in the first half of 2024. However, this rebound is still far from the figures achieved in previous years. The report highlights an increase of 2.1% in terms of value and 14% in volume compared to the previous year, but the drop in the unit value of exports, which has decreased by more than 10%, raised concerns about the sustainability of this recovery. The average price has fallen to 1.8 euros per liter, but Chilean exports are still not reaching the sales figures of 2022, going from 1.8 billion dollars in annual exports to approximately 1.3 billion at the end of 2023.
